Leucospermum (Pin Cushion Flower)

Leucospermum (Pincushion, Pincushion Protea or Leucospermum) is a genus of about 50 species of flowering plants in the family Proteaceae, native to Zimbabwe and South Africa, where they occupy a variety of habitats, including scrub, forest, and mountain slopes.

They are evergreen shrubs (rarely small trees) growing to 0.5-5 m tall. The leaves are spirally arranged, tough and leathery, simple, linear to lanceolate, 2-12 cm long and 0.5-3 cm broad, with a serrated margin or serrated at the leaf apex only. The flowers are produced in dense inflorescences, which have large numbers of prominent styles, which inspires the name.

The genus is closely related in evolution and appearance to the Australian genus Banksia.

Local Variations in South Africa from our Farm Suppliers:






List of Variations of Pin Cushion Flowers:



Leucospermum album Bond
Leucospermum arenarium – Redelinghuis Pincushion
Leucospermum attenuatum R.Br.
Leucospermum bolusii E.Phillips – Gordon's Bay Pincushion
Leucospermum calligerum – Arid Pincushion
Leucospermum catherinae Compton – Catherine-wheel Pincushion
Leucospermum conocarpodendron (L.) H.St.John – Tree Pincushion
Leucospermum conocarpum R.Br.
Leucospermum cordatum – Heart-leaf Pincushion
Leucospermum cordifolium (Salisb. ex Knight) Fourc.
Leucospermum cuneiforme (Burm.) Rourke – Wart-stemmed Pincushion
Leucospermum erubescens – Oudtshoorn Pincushion
Leucospermum formosum – Silver-leaf Wheel Pincushion
Leucospermum gerrardii – Soapstone Pincushion
Leucospermum glabrum – Outeniqua Pincushion
Leucospermum gracile – Hermanus Pincushion
Leucospermum grandiflorum R.Br. – Grey-leaf Fountain Pincushion
Leucospermum gueinzii – Kloof Fountain Pincushion
Leucospermum harmatum – Ruitersbos Pincushion
Leucospermum harpagonatum – McGregor Pincushion
Leucospermum heterophyllum – Trident Pincushion
Leucospermum hypophyllocarpodendron (L.) Druce – Snake-stem Pincushion
Leucospermum innovans – Transkei Pincushion
Leucospermum lineare R.Br. – Needle-leaf Pincushion
Leucospermum muirii – Albertinia Pincushion
Leucospermum mundii – Langeberg Pincushion
Leucospermum oleifolium – Overberg Pincushion
Leucospermum parile – Malmesbury Pincushion
Leucospermum patersonii – Silveredge Pincushion
Leucospermum pendunculatum – White Trailing Pincushion
Leucospermum pluridens – Robinson Pincushion
Leucospermum praecox – Mossel Bay Pincushion
Leucospermum praemorsum – Nardouw Pincushion
Leucospermum profugum – Piketberg Pincushion
Leucospermum prostratum – Yellow Trailing Pincushion
Leucospermum reflexum H.Buek ex Meisn. – Rocket Pincushion
Leucospermum rodolentum – Common Sandveld Pincushion
Leucospermum royenifolium – Eastern Pincushion
Leucospermum saxatile – Karoo Pincushion
Leucospermum saxosum – Escarpment Pincushion
Leucospermum secundifolium – Stalked Pincushion
Leucospermum spathulatum – Cederberg Pincushion
Leucospermum tomentosus – Saldanha Pincushion
Leucospermum tottum R.Br. – Ribbon Pincushion
Leucospermum truncatulum – Oval-leaf Pincushion
Leucospermum truncatum H.Buek ex Meisn. – Limestone Pincushion
Leucospermum utriculosum – Breede River Pincushion
Leucospermum vestitum (Lam.) Rourke – Silky-haired Pincushion
Leucospermum winterii – Riversdale Pincushion
Leucospermum wittebergense – Swartberg Pincushion
